Female Care Assistant - Driver with Own Vehicle

We have clients in Burnley and surrounding areas

Pay Rate: 14.24 per hour (including holiday pay) + 30p per mile

Important Unfortunately, Routes are unable to offer a job to anyone who does not have the right to work in the UK or needs employer support.

Female Requirement: This role is advertised for female care assistants only as a Genuine Occupational Requirement under Schedule 9, Part 1 of the Equality Act 2010, to meet the specific care needs of our clients.

About Us

Routes Healthcare is a leading homecare provider - we are a care company, not an agency. We're real people who put individual healthcare needs first. We support people in their own homes (not in care homes) and out in the community, taking the time to listen to our clients and making sure their needs are met with care and consideration.

About The Role

This is a homecare position - you'll be travelling to clients' homes throughout the day to provide person-centred care and support.

What You'll Be Doing
  • Visiting vulnerable and palliative clients in their own homes
  • Providing personal care with dignity and respect
  • Supporting with medication management
  • Assisting with meal preparation and nutrition
  • Working solo or as part of a 2-person team depending on client needs
  • Supporting clients with a variety of different care requirements
  • Travelling between client visits throughout your shift
What Makes This Different

We support people who need complex care services for long‑term health conditions, clinically‑led enhanced homecare, and end‑of‑life care. All focused on supporting each individual's lifestyle and wellbeing.

We are committed to making lives better 24 hours a day, 7 days a week - not only for the people we support but their loved ones and family members too.
